As the world grapples with the challenges of climate change, green power systems are emerging as a beacon of hope. These innovative solutions harness the power of renewable energy sources, such as solar, wind, and hydro, to create a cleaner, more sustainable energy future. And it’s not just the environment that benefits – green power systems are also driving economic growth and job creation.

One of the key drivers of the green power revolution is the increasing adoption of solar energy. According to the International Energy Agency (IEA), solar power capacity has grown by over 500% in the past decade, with solar panels now being installed at a rate of over 100 gigawatts per year. This rapid growth is being fueled by declining panel prices, improving technology, and supportive policies from governments around the world.

But solar is just one part of the green power equation. Wind power, in particular, has emerged as a major player in the renewable energy landscape. Offshore wind farms, which harness the power of wind turbines located in the ocean, are becoming increasingly popular, with the UK, Germany, and China leading the way. These massive projects are not only reducing carbon emissions but also creating thousands of jobs and stimulating local economies.

Hydroelectric power, meanwhile, remains one of the oldest and most reliable forms of renewable energy. While it’s not as flashy as solar or wind, hydro has a crucial role to play in the transition to a low-carbon economy. In fact, hydroelectric power is already providing over 15% of the world’s electricity, with major dams like the Three Gorges Dam in China and the Itaipu Dam in Brazil serving as iconic examples of large-scale renewable energy production.

So, what’s driving the growth of green power systems? For starters, governments around the world are implementing policies to support the transition to a low-carbon economy. In the US, for example, the Tax Cuts and Jobs Act of 2017 included provisions to incentivize renewable energy development, while the European Union’s Clean Energy Package sets ambitious targets for renewable energy growth.

But it’s not just governments that are pushing the green power agenda. The private sector is also playing a crucial role, with companies like Vestas, Siemens Gamesa, and GE Renewable Energy leading the charge in renewable energy technology development. And consumers are also driving demand for green power, with many opting for renewable energy tariffs or investing in solar panels for their homes.

As we look to the future, it’s clear that green power systems will play an increasingly important role in shaping the world’s energy landscape. Whether it’s solar, wind, hydro, or a combination of these and other renewable energy sources, the path forward is clear: a cleaner, more sustainable energy future is within our grasp. And with the cost of green power systems continuing to drop, it’s an investment worth making.
